			Never really understood the facination with venies. Is it just rarity? Maybe some people grew up there and remember these fondly? Seems pretty esoteric otherwise.

			Thrill of the hunt, it's the next phase for a player collector or a team collector who has finished with all of the easily found Topps cards and semi easily found OPC cards. Had to pay a small fortune for this little booger, might not see another one in ten years.
